The game is based on the arcade [[Donkey Kong (game)|game of the same]], while also borrowing artwork from the [[Game Boy]] [[Donkey Kong (Game Boy)|game of the same name]]. Not much is known about the gameplay; however, a screenshot of the game shows that it takes place in a location similar to [[25m]], with many [[ladder]]s, [[girder]]s, and an [[oil drum]]. Both [[Donkey Kong]] and a kidnapped [[Pauline]] are at the top of the screen, with Donkey Kong shown to be throwing [[barrel]]s (most likely at [[Mario]]).<ref>[https://images-na.ssl-images-amazon.com/images/I/51SHG8KKEEL._SX425_.jpg Dynatech Donkey Kong]</ref> | ||
